The North Shore residential areas in New South Wales, such as Mosman, Hornsby, Chatswood, and Turramurra, include a mix of modern-day and older homes that present a special environment for electrical infrastructure. While a basic electrician is necessary for internal electrical wiring and lighting, the expertise of Level 2 Electricians North Shore is vital for the connections between your home and the primary North Shore Level 2 Electricians electrical grid. These certified professionals are licensed to work on the network side of your electrical meter, linking the general public electrical energy network with your private property's switchboard.
Being acknowledged as a Level 2 Electrician in North Shore goes beyond a basic label; it encompasses important aspects of security, following regulations, and having the needed abilities. Accredited Service Providers (ASPs) in this category have received accreditation from the state government, indicating their sophisticated training and licensing. This enables them to undertake complex and dangerous jobs that regular electricians are not equipped to manage. An important function that Level 2 Electricians North Shore offer is the maintenance and replacement of private power poles on residential properties, especially those with bigger, more rural blocks in Upper North Shore residential areas. As homeowner are responsible for the maintenance of these poles, they require the proficiency of a certified Level 2 electrician when the poles end up being damaged due to age. These proficient specialists supervise the entire replacement process, starting with the safe disconnection of the power supply, setup of a brand-new wood or steel pole, and finishing with the reconnection of overhead lines, guaranteeing all work complies with NSW's rigorous electrical standards. Neglecting a malfunctioning private power pole positions serious safety threats and is likewise against the law, however highly skilled specialists can deal with the concern without delay and effectively.
Furthermore, the increasing demand for high-capacity electrical systems in modern-day homes and organizations typically demands a switchboard upgrade, or even an entire power upgrade from single-phase to three-phase power. Setting up electric vehicle battery chargers, ducted a/c, or significant industrial equipment can overload older electrical facilities. The process of upgrading the switchboard, setting up new metering, and possibly upgrading the primary customer cables that connect to the street network all fall within the special domain of Level 2 Electricians North Shore. They possess the requisite knowledge to evaluate your current capability, style a compliant upgrade, and liaise with the regional electrical energy distributor, such as Ausgrid or Endeavour Energy, for the needed disconnection and reconnection of power, a job clearly restricted to Accredited Company.
